Details
A vulnerability classified as critical has been found in SQLite up to 3.8.8. Affected is the function sqlite3VXPrintf of the file printf.c.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a memory corruption v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-119. The product performs operations on a memory buffer, but it can read from or write to a memory location that is outside of the intended boundary of the buffer. This is going to have an imp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ability. CVE summarizes:
The sqlite3VXPrintf function in printf.c in SQLite before 3.8.9 does not properly handle precision and width values during floating-point conversions, which allows context-dependent attackers to cause a denial of service (integer overflow and stack-based buffer overflow) or possibly have unspecified other impact via large integers in a crafted printf function call in a SELECT statement.
The weakness was disclosed 04/24/2015 by Michal Zalewski (Website). The advisory is shared for download at sqlite.org. This vulnerability is traded as CVE-2015-3416 since 04/24/2015. It is possible to launch the attack remotely. The exploitation doesn't require any form of authentication. There are known technical details, but no exploit is available.
The vulnerability scanner Nessus provides a plugin with the ID 83273 (Debian DSA-3252-1 : sqlite3 - security update), which helps to determine the existence of the flaw in a target environment. It is assigned to the family Debian Local Security Checks. The commercial vulnerability scanner Qualys is able to test this issue with plugin 350141 (Amazon Linux Security Advisory for php54: ALAS-2015-561).
Upgrading to version 3.8.9 eliminates this vulnerability.
